WebRainscaping Guide: Rainwater Harvesting. Rain barrels are a small version of an above-ground cistern. They can range in size from 50 to 200 gallons, in contrast to cisterns that range in size from 100 to 1500 gallons or more. Rain barrels decrease rainwater runoff by collecting and storing rainwater from the roof.
